Isak ready to Slot back in for PSG clash

Daily Record

|

March 21, 2026

But boss says he won't be at best

- ARNE SLOT

says Alexander Isak will be back in time for Liverpool's Champions League quarterfinal clash with PSG next month.

But he has urged caution regarding when supporters can expect to see the best of the £125million striker, who has been injured since late 2025.

Isak broke his leg in the 2-1 win over Tottenham on December 20 when he was caught by defender Micky van de Ven after opening the scoring following his second-half introduction in London.

The Sweden star is back in light training but will not be linking up with his international teammates during the break as he continues to go through the final stages of his rehab before returning to action with his club colleagues.
